Output 24ce8b309cef653c220dd94bfa0909b53649538611c5733b5556ef75349e992f:62

value
105065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502f6271d9f4503e39abb23350fb20c4abf6ba50 OP_EQUAL
address
38zzkE5wCW1VYBEeTeKcsQ6rLHxj3QLq4E
transaction
24ce8b309cef653c220dd94bfa0909b53649538611c5733b5556ef75349e992f
spent
true